Shortsleeve pigment dyed tee. - Screenprinted graphics. - Ribbed collar. - 100% Cotton. - Imported. *This garment has … WebApr 8, 2024 · Apart from the green pigment in plants, Carotenoids, Flavonoids, and Betalains are some of the other plant pigments. When it comes to fruits and vegetables, color pigments are present in them too. To name a few, the yellow pigment found in them is called Lutein whereas the red pigment in plants is Lycopene.

WebNov 25, 2024 · In flowers, it means success, tradition, and admiration. Give purple flowers to a respected mentor. Green: Rare, green flowers symbolize rebirth, new life, renewal, good fortune, good health, and youthfulness. Give green Fuji mums or button flowers to someone you wish well.
